Scripts gebruiken
Wie moet scripts maken?
Belangrijk: Het is belangrijk dat de scripts worden gemaakt door een gekwalificeerde webontwikkelaar met een goed begrip van webgebeurtenissen en CSS-selectors. Script-auteurs moeten ook een goed inzicht hebben in de omstandigheden die ervoor kunnen zorgen dat een bepaalde pagina met iets andere inhoud wordt geladen, zoals schermgrootte, user agent of routinematige inhoudupdates. Cruciaal is dat script-auteurs ook vertrouwd zijn met welke event hooks de pagina gebruikt om gebruikersinvoer te verwerken.
Wanneer moeten scripts worden gebruikt?
Hoewel u vrij bent om scripts in axe Monitor te gebruiken zoals u nuttig acht, volgen hier enkele goede en slechte gebruikssituaties ter overweging:
Goede voorbeelden
De volgende toepassingen van scripts met axe Monitor® worden vaak met succes gebruikt om belangrijke taken op de te testen pagina's uit te voeren:
- Gebruikersnaam/Wachtwoord Invoer & Verzending: Beveiligde sessievestiging die het inloggen met authenticatie automatiseert, essentieel voor toegang tot met wachtwoord beveiligde pagina's en sites.
- Analyse van Gebruikersinvoerinteracties, zoals:
- Zoeken: Een zoekopdracht uitvoeren op een website.
- Basisinteracties met webapplicaties: Het sluiten van een waarschuwingsdialoogvenster, het toevoegen van items aan een winkelwagen (wanneer niet-dynamisch).
Slechte voorbeelden
De volgende toepassingen van scripts met axe Monitor® staan bekend om het potentieel om frustraties te veroorzaken vanwege de beperkingen van de op de te testen pagina's gebruikte technologieën:
- Q&A Chat Ondersteuningsbots: Pogingen om opmerkingen-/vraagformulieren bots en vergelijkbare interactieve chat-pop-up-plug-ins te omzeilen/negeren die voor klantenservice worden gebruikt.
- Dynamische sites: Sites en pagina's waarvan de inhoud niet statisch is, kunnen veranderen bij volgende scans, wat kan verhinderen dat scripts werken.
Hoe worden scripts gemaakt?
Scripts kunnen worden gemaakt met behulp van axe DevTools CLI en vervolgens worden geüpload naar een axe Monitor-scan met de knop Script toevoegen in de wizard Scan maken of bewerken in axe Monitor. Use case-scripts kunnen inhoud analyseren in axe Monitor. Scripts vereisen minstens één analyzestap, en alleen de gespecificeerde pagina's worden gescand (subpagina's worden niet gescand).
Om meer te weten te komen over voorbeeldbestanden voor CLI, lees het onderwerp, Voorbeeld CLI-scriptbestanden.
